Sinking Precharge and Enable Inputs - using internal power
supply

Enable - In sinking configuration. this circuit must
connect to 24V DC return for drive to run.

Precharge
Precharge control is used in common bus
configurations and is not required for AC fed drives.

If precharge control is not required, reprogram Par
838 [DigIn 1 Sel] to a value of zero or replace the
contact shown with a jumper from Terminal 8 to
Terminal 11.

If precharge is needed, in sinking configuration,
this circuit must connect to 24V DC return for drive
to complete the precharge cycle.

Digital Outputs - 24V DC
outputs 25 mA maximum per
output

Digital Output 1 Indicating Alarm and Digital Output 2
Indicating Fault - in sourcing configuration

• Link Parameter 155 [Logic Status], the source,

to Parameter 843 [DigOut 1 Data], the sink

• Set Parameter 844 [DigOut 1 Bit] to a value of

eight, so that parameter 155 [Logic Status] / bit 8
“Alarm” will control the output

• Link Parameter 155 [Logic Status], the source,

to Parameter 845 [DigOut 2 Data], the sink

Set Parameter 846 [DigOut 2 Bit] to a value of
seven, so that Parameter 155 [Logic Status] / bit 7
[Faulted] will control the output

Digital Output - 24V DC
output 25 mA maximum per
output.

If one (1) output is configured
in sinking, the other output is
not available.

Digital Output 1 Indicating Alarm Fault - in sinking
configuration

• Link Parameter 155 [Logic Status], the source,

to Parameter 843 [DigOut 1 Data], the sink

Set Parameter 844 [DigOut 1 Bit] to a value of 8, so
that Parameter 155 [Logic Status] / bit 8 “Alarm”
will control the output
